 /* General page style. The scroll bar colours only visible in IE5.5+ */
body {
	background-color: #EDEBEB;
	scrollbar-face-color: #68220C;
	scrollbar-highlight-color: #708090;
	scrollbar-shadow-color: #68220C;
	scrollbar-3dlight-color: #D4D0C8;
	scrollbar-arrow-color: #EAC5B2;
	scrollbar-track-color: #471808;
	scrollbar-darkshadow-color: #68220C;
	
}

p, td, span {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: Black;
	font-size : 11px;
}
hr        {
        height: 0px;
        border: 0px dotted #CCCCCC;
        border-top-width: 1px;
}


/*links  */
a        {
	font-size : 11px;
	text-decoration: underline;
	color : #4E2816;
}
a:visited {
	text-decoration: underline;
	color : #9C512C;
}
a:hover{
	text-decoration: none;
	color : Maroon;
}

.bgDarkBrown{
	background-color: #68220C;
}

.bgDarkRed{
	background-color: #330000;
}

.bgBorderLeft{ 
background-image: url(../images/s5l_border_left.gif);
 }
 
 .bgBorderRight{ 
background-image: url(../images/s5l_border_right.gif);
 }
 
/*top menue*/
td.topBg{
	
	background-color: #68220C;
	padding-left: 5px;
}

a.topmenu        {
	font: bold 11px "Times New Roman";
	padding-left: 5px;
	text-decoration: underline;
	color : #FFF8DC;
}
a.topmenu:visited {
	text-decoration: underline;
	color : #FADBD1;
}
a.topmenu:hover{
	text-decoration: underline;
	color : #F5F5F5;
}

/*user Login Breich */
td.userBg{
	background-color: #F0E1C2;
	padding-left: 5px;
	font: 10px Arial;
}

td.loginBg{
	background-color: #68220C;
}


a.user        {
	font: bold 10px "Times New Roman";
	text-decoration: underline;
	color : #FFF8DC;
}
a.user:visited {
	text-decoration: underline;
	color : #FADBD1;
}
a.user:hover{
	text-decoration: underline;
	color : #F5F5F5;
}

/*submenue   */

td.submenuBg{
	background-color: #EADCBF;
	padding-left: 5px;
	
}

a.submenu        {
	font: bold 11px "Times New Roman";
	text-decoration: underline;
	color : #191970;
}
a.submenu:visited {
	text-decoration: underline;
	color : #191970;
}
a.submenu:hover{
	text-decoration: underline;
	color : Maroon;
}


/*Background und Text, links für den Inhalt, Event usw*/
td.yellowBg {
	background-color: #F0E1C2;
}

td.greenBg {
	background-color: #B6BA93;
}

td.yellowBgRight {
	background-image: url(../images/box_yellow_right_bg.gif);
	
}
td.yellowBgLeft {
	background-image: url(../images/s5l_boxLeft_left_02.gif);
	
}
td.redTitel{
		font: bold 11px "Times New Roman";
		background-image: url(../images/s5l_label_red_middle_bg.gif);
		color: #F5F5F5;
		
}

td.blueTitel{
		font: bold 11px "Times New Roman";
		background-image: url(../images/s5l_label_blue_middle_bg.gif);
		color: #F5F5F5;
		
}

td.greenTitel{
		font: bold 11px "Times New Roman";
		background-image: url(../images/s5l_label_darkGrey_middle_b.gif);
		color: #F5F5F5;
		
}

#contentTitel SPAN {
		font: bold 14px "Times New Roman";
		color: #F5F5F5;
		margin-left: 30px;
		margin-top: 10px;
}

.contentText {
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 5px;
	padding-bottom: 5px;
}
td.Titel{
        color: Black;
        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
        font-size: 12px;
        font: italic bolder;
		background-color: #F0E68C;
}

.genSmall, .genNormal, .genBig{
        color: White;
        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.genSmall{
        font-size: 10px;
}

.genNormal{
        font-size: 11px;
}

.genBig{
        font-size: 12px;
       
}

/* schwarze Schriften */

.genTextSmall, .genTextNormal, .genTextBig{
        color: black;
        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.genTextSmall{
        font-size: 10px;
}

.genTextNormal{
        font-size: 11px;
}

.genTextBig{
        font-size: 12px;
       
}
/*fette Schriftarten*/
.genSmallb, .genNormalb, .genBigb{
	color: Silver;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ight:bold;
}

.genSmallb{
        font-size: 10px;
}

.genNormalb{
        font-size: 11px;
}

.genBigb{
        font-size: 12px;

}
/*weiße fette Schriftarten*/

.genSmallw, .genNormalw, .genBigw{
        color: White;
        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
        font-weight:bold;
}

.genSmallw{
        font-size: 10px;
}

.genNormalw{
        font-size: 11px;
}

.genBigw{
        font-size: 12px;

}

/*Schriftarten für Tabellen*/

.genHead{
        font-size: 10px;
		color: White;
        font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
        font-weight:bold;
		 border: 1px solid #006E25;
        background-color: #4A6D4A;
		
}
a.genHead                { text-decoration: underline; color :#FFFFFF; }
a.genHead:visited{ color :#FFFFFF; text-decoration: underline; }
a.genHead:hover{ color : #FFFFFF; text-decoration: underline; }


.genRow1{
	font-family: Tahoma;
	font-size: 10px;
	color: Black;
	background-color : #EBD3B6;
}

.genRow2{
       font-family: Tahoma;
		font-size: 10px;
		background-color : #ECAD7D;
		color: Black;
}

/* styles für den copyright Bereich */
.copyright {
color : #778899;
font-size: 10px;
font: italic;
font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}

a.copyright                { text-decoration: none; color :#778899; }
a.copyright:visited{ color :#778899; text-decoration: none; }
a.copyright:hover{ color : #778899; text-decoration: underline; }

/* Counter TEXT und Background */
.backcounter        {
        border: 2px solid #006E25;
        background-color: #4A6D4A;
        }
td.counterText{
        color: Black;
        font-size: 9px;
}
/*MESSAGE BOXEN */
.smallborder
{ border: 1px solid #A52A2A; }

.bigborder
{ 
background-color: #B6BA93;
border: 2px solid #A52A2A;
 }

/* Form elements */
input,textarea, select {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#FFF5EE;
	background-color: #68220C;
	border-color: #FAEBD7 #FAEBD7;
	
}

input { text-indent : 2px; }

/* The buttons used for bbCode styling in message post */
input.button {
     border-style: outset;
}

/* The main submit button option */
input.mainoption {
        background-color : #000000;
        font-weight : bold;
}

/* None-bold submit button */
input.liteoption {
        background-color : #000000;
        font-weight : normal;
}



